Parental burnout is a pressing issue that extends beyond typical stress, manifesting in emotional exhaustion, detachment, and feelings of ineffectiveness. This phenomenon can lead to serious consequences, including neglect and even violence, highlighting the need for awareness and intervention. Factors contributing to parental burnout often include individual circumstances, interpersonal relationships, and broader cultural pressures.
Parents today face immense challenges, from balancing work and family life to managing societal expectations. The constant demands of parenting can leave individuals feeling overwhelmed and isolated. It is essential for parents to recognize the signs of burnout early on and take proactive steps to alleviate its impact.
To combat parental burnout, experts suggest several strategies. Prioritizing self-care, seeking support from friends or family, setting realistic expectations, and carving out personal time can significantly help in recharging one's emotional batteries. Additionally, fostering open communication within the family can create a more supportive environment, reducing the feelings of isolation that often accompany burnout. By acknowledging and addressing these challenges, parents can work towards a healthier, more balanced approach to parenting.
